[1] In 2013, Bousrez created a surprise by winning the Natureman, ahead of the favorite Alexandra Louison, whom she beat by 32 seconds at the end, for her first participation in this long-distance triathlon.
Without failing, she finished the second run and crossed the line as the winner to win her first national title.
[3] In 2017, she won her second national title in long-distance duathlon in Verruyes, she completed a high-level bike course that largely made up for the fifteen-second delay in the first run.
[4] In 2018, she won her third French long-distance duathlon champion title at the end of a race that took place in difficult weather conditions.
In difficulty at the end of the swimming section where she only came out in 12th position, the race was led by the young Léna Berthelot Moritz, 21 years old.
